Vodafone Fiji 7s coach Ben Ryan has said that he wanted to make five changes after the Hong Kong 7s however he had to change his decision.
Speaking to Fijivillage in Singapore, Ryan said some players like Jerry Tuwai and Masivesi Dakuwaqa put in a lot of hard work during training in Singapore.
Ryan said his forwards will need to step up as players like Pio Tuwai and Isake Katonibau are not in the team this week.

Meanwhile, Osea Kolinisau will become the first Fijian player to play his 50th HSBC 7s tournament this weekend.

Fiji takes on Samoa at 4.12pm today in their first pool match of the Singapore 7s.
We then take on Portugal at 7.33 tonight.
Our last pool match is against England at 11.26 tonight.
The Cup quarterfinals kick off at 3.58pm tomorrow, the Cup semifinals start at 8.28pm tomorrow while the Cup final kicks off at 11.38pm tomorrow.
